FOXBOROUGH – The end is in sight for the grind that is training camp.

The Pats held a brief hour-and-a-half practice on Saturday afternoon without fans for the first time, signaling the near end of camp ahead of the final preseason game in Washington next Sunday. While it was a short, non-padded session, there were still plenty of good nuggets coming out of it…

-No Calvin Anderson or or Nick Leverett. Austin Hooper got injured in practice (I think it was something to do with his left leg) and did not finish practice. Oshane Ximinies was in a hoodie with his practice jersey over it and was only strolling around the sidelines. On a positive note, both Marcus Jones and Jonathan Jones were out there, which Mayo said following Thursday night’s game that they were both ‘very close.’

-It was definitely a bit odd not having fans out there, cool but weird being able to hear what coaches and players are yelling.

-Speaking of yelling, Mayo got on the team early in practice for guys not being in the right spots or knowing where to go.

-Jacoby Brissett still took all first team reps (7-on-7 and 11’s) before Drake Maye. But, New England rotated Chukwuma Okorafor, Mike Onwenu and Caedan Wallace at right tackle. There’s either two takeaways with this: either they’re just trying to throw the media through a loop so we all can’t report the exact unit Maye is working with, or, they’re understanding of the spot they’re in right now and saying ‘screw it, everyone’s going to get a shot to play everywhere and we’ll see what the best 5 are.”
